The Solution: Nickel Fan Downrods for Optimal Airflow

A fan downrod is an extension pole that connects your ceiling fan to the mounting bracket. It lowers the fan, bringing it closer to the living space and maximizing its airflow. A nickel finish downrod adds a stylish touch, blending seamlessly with a variety of décor styles.

Choosing the Right Length and Finish

Selecting the correct length is crucial. As a general rule, your ceiling fan blades should be between 8 and 9 feet from the floor. To determine the appropriate downrod length, measure the distance from your ceiling to the desired blade height and subtract the height of your fan motor.

Consider the finish as well. A brushed nickel fan downrod offers a subtle, matte look, while a polished nickel fan downrod provides a shiny, reflective surface. An antique nickel fan downrod adds a vintage charm, and a satin nickel fan downrod offers a smooth, velvety appearance.

Commonly Asked Questions About Nickel Fan Downrods

Q: How does a fan downrod enhance the look of my ceiling fan?

A: A downrod provides a beautiful and proportional aesthetic to your fan, ensuring it hangs at the ideal height for optimal performance and visual appeal in your room. It truly completes the overall design!

Q: What benefits does using the correct downrod length offer?

A: Using the right downrod ensures your ceiling fan circulates air effectively and efficiently throughout the room. It helps to maximize the cooling or warming effect, creating a more comfortable environment.

Q: Are fan downrods available in different finishes to match my fan?

A: Absolutely! Downrods come in a variety of finishes, allowing you to perfectly coordinate with your ceiling fan and other room hardware. This helps create a cohesive and stylish look throughout your space.

Q: How do I determine the appropriate downrod length for my ceiling height?

A: Selecting the right downrod length depends on your ceiling height, and we recommend that you refer to the manufacturer's guidelines for the fan you intend to purchase. However, a professional electrician will be able to assist you in determining the perfect length for your space, ensuring both safety and optimal performance.

Q: Can a longer downrod help with airflow in rooms with high ceilings?

A: Yes, a longer downrod is often the perfect solution for rooms with higher ceilings. It brings the fan down to a level where it can more effectively circulate the air, making a significant difference in comfort.
